From my /etc/inittab
# modem getty. mo:235:respawn:/usr/sbin/mgetty -s 38400 ttyS4
# fax getty (hylafax) mo:35:respawn:/usr/lib/fax/faxgetty /dev/ttyS4
Try commenting out the modem's line there and running with just the fax. Haven't checked the documentation lately and its been awhile since I set this up so I don't remember if this is an either/or situation. Modem or fax but not both.
I know that if just the fax getty is running it will work.
I understand you may have both devices running, but only one handler. Ie, use a getty that diferentiates when the incoming call is a modem or a fax and that calls the appropiate program to handle it.
